• DocumentCode
    2546746
  • Title

    Particle Swarm Optimization for Run-Time Task Decomposition and Scheduling in Evolvable MPSoC

  • Author

    Vakili, Shervin ; Fakhraie, S. Mehdi ; Mohammadi, Siamak ; Ahmadi, Ali

  • Author_Institution
    Silicon Intell. & VLSI Signal Process. Lab., Univ. of Tehran, Tehran
  • Volume
    2
  • fYear
    2009
  • fDate
    22-24 Jan. 2009
  • Firstpage
    28
  • Lastpage
    32
  • Abstract
    Decomposition and scheduling are two major challenges in hardware and software developments of multiprocessor systems. The introduced EvoMP (Evolvable MultiProcessor) is a novel NoC-based homogeneous MPSoC system that performs decomposition and scheduling using evolutionary algorithms at run-time. A hardware genetic core was used in first version of this platform to perform these two tasks. This core tries to find an efficient solution for decomposition and scheduling of the target application among available computational resources. This paper presents the new version of this system in which a hardware particle swarm optimization (PSO) core is exploited to perform evolutionary decomposition and scheduling. The principle of operation and architecture of the EvoMP platform and the PSO core is briefly explained in this paper. The simulation and synthesis results of this PSO-based EvoMP is also presented and compared with prior genetic-base approach.
  • Keywords
    evolutionary computation; network-on-chip; particle swarm optimisation; processor scheduling; NoC-based homogeneous multiprocessor SoC system; evolutionary algorithms; evolvable multiprocessor; particle swarm optimization; run-time task decomposition; run-time task scheduling; Computer applications; Computer architecture; Evolutionary computation; Genetics; Hardware; Multiprocessing systems; Particle swarm optimization; Processor scheduling; Programming; Runtime; MPSoC; Particle Swarm Optimization;
  • fLanguage
    English
  • Publisher
    ieee
  • Conference_Titel
    Computer Engineering and Technology, 2009. ICCET '09. International Conference on
  • Conference_Location
    Singapore
  • Print_ISBN
    978-1-4244-3334-6
  • Type

    conf

  • DOI
    10.1109/ICCET.2009.197
  • Filename
    4769552